The freaks return with Circus of Horrors

A GRUESOME parade of freaks is descending upon the Leighton area in the name of jaw-dropping entertainment.

The Circus of Horrors, making its third appearance at The Grove, has become a bit of a cult hit but it is not for the fainthearted and definitely not for children. This is X-rated stuff that will give youngsters nightmares so leave the little ones at home.

This group of freaks and acrobats have been touring for years but recently presented a cleaned up version of the show to great success on Britain’s Got Talent. Their lurid new show comes to The Waterside next Tuesday (17th) and The Grove on January 21 at 7.30pm.

Set amid 1920s Berlin, MC Dr Haze brings his weird and wonderful Vampire Vaudeville show to town and it features a mesmerising new act - The Ventriloquist.

The show features all the usual hair-hanging beauties, twisted contortionists, flying aerialists, demon dwarfs, gyrating jugglers, voodoo warriors, pickled people and sword swallowers but this latest addition brings a macabre twist to the evening (think Chucky or, actually, any number of demonic dolls from the movies).

Inspired by evil ventriloquist movies like Devil Doll and The Dead of Night, the story will send shivers down the spine as a demonic dummy begins to take on a life of its own.

Those of us who have seen their previous performances at the venue know that you’re in for an unforgettable evening that will shock, appal and amaze.
